Dumka vs Moro, Or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Dumka, India and Moro, Or, Usa is approximately 11,797 km or 7,331 mi.
  • To reach Dumka in this distance one would set out from Moro, Or bearing 333.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Dumka bearing 200.4° or SSW .
  • Dumka has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Moro, Or has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
  • Dumka is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Moro, Or is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 16.6 °C (29.9°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.9 °C (14.2°F) less in Dumka.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1108.7 mm (43.6 in) more which is equivalent to 1108.7 l/m² (27.21 US gal/ft²) or 11,087,000 l/ha (1,185,274 US gal/ac) more. About 5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.7° higher in Dumka than in Moro, Or.
